Output c530b7a5913b25c379de058239de6727529764e3299a5072762a375870059d5f:12

value
3438368
script pubkey
OP_0 OP_PUSHBYTES_20 1a709cf0fb858ea5a0190a406602a8e5eba9001c
address
bc1qrfcfeu8msk82tgqepfqxvq4guh46jqqu5xqc7a
transaction
c530b7a5913b25c379de058239de6727529764e3299a5072762a375870059d5f
spent
true